Public Reacts as Seyi Tinubu Shares Romantic Moments with Wife, Expresses Gratitude for Her Love
Seyi Tinubu, the son of Nigeria’s President Bola Ahmed Tinubu, has stirred positive reactions online after sharing a series of romantic photos with his wife, Layal Tinubu. The businessman and philanthropist used the heartfelt post to show appreciation for his wife’s constant love and support.
In the images, Seyi and Layal are seen enjoying tender, joyful moments together, exuding a strong sense of connection and affection. Alongside the photos, Seyi penned an emotional message in which he praised Layal for standing by his side through life’s ups and downs.
The post quickly went viral, drawing admiration across various social media platforms. Many users commended the couple’s love and unity, with some speculating that the post may have marked a private celebration like an anniversary or personal milestone, even though no specific occasion was mentioned.
Reactions in the comment section were overwhelmingly positive, as fans and well-wishers showered the couple with blessings and congratulatory remarks. Some applauded Seyi for embracing and promoting family values, while others admired the bond and chemistry between him and Layal.
This isn’t the first time Seyi has openly celebrated his wife. Despite occasional rumors about strain in their relationship, the couple has consistently appeared united, regularly attending public and private events together.
With this latest post, Seyi Tinubu has once again highlighted the strength of their relationship, reaffirming the admiration many Nigerians hold for the younger generation of the Tinubu family.
